September 25, 1964: Phillies suffer 5th straight defeat despite late homers by Johnny Callison, Dick Allen
The Philadelphia Phillies returned home on September 21, 1964, holding first place in the National League after winning six games on a three-city road trip. With 12 games to play, Philadelphia’s lead was 6½ games over the second-place Cincinnati Reds and St. Louis Cardinals. The city and team were looking forward to the World Series. […]
